Position: Personal Assistant for Attorney (Bilingual Spanish/English) - Early Career Friendly -

Responsibilities

  • Manage daily emails by organizing and prioritizing messages, and oversee calendar management, scheduling, and reminders.
  • Maintain regular communication with key members of the legal and administrative team; respond professionally to inquiries as needed.
  • Play a central role in managing engagement across social media platforms by responding to comments and direct messages and building rapport to identify and process potential leads.
  • Assist with running errands, arranging travel, coordinating logistics, and handling administrative tasks related to personal and family matters.
  • Communicate with outside service providers and handle time-sensitive requests as they arise.
  • Demonstrate flexibility, strong judgment, and willingness to step in wherever support is needed.
Qualifications
  • Fluency in Spanish and English (spoken and written) is required.
  • Several years of varied work experience after high school with demonstrated reliability, leadership, and strong communication skills in prior roles.
  • Experience in structured environments with significant responsibility—such as administrative support, team leadership, customer-facing roles, or cross-cultural settings—is highly valued.
  • Organized, dependable, and comfortable interacting with a wide range of people.
  • Positive attitude, strong work ethic, and ability to stay composed in a fast-paced, changing environment.
  • Valid driver’s license is required.
  • Prior assistant experience is helpful but not required for the right candidate.
Additional Information
  • This is a full-time, in-office position with hours from 8:30 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. Some limited overtime may be required depending on workload or time-sensitive needs. This position is not remote.
  • Compensation is $20–$22 per hour, depending on experience.
  • Paid time off is offered after 90 days, along with health and dental benefits.
  • This role is well-suited for someone seeking meaningful, hands-on professional experience for approximately 12–18 months in a dynamic legal and business environment.
